.about01{padding:60px 0;display:flex;align-items:center;justify-content:space-between;}
.about01 .text{width:655px;box-sizing: border-box;}
.about01 .text h3.title{margin-bottom:55px;}
.about01 .text h4{font-size:20px;font-weight:bold;color:#666666;line-height:30px;margin-bottom:15px;}
.about01 .text p{font-size:18px;line-height:28px;color:#666666;}
.about02{display:flex;position: relative;justify-content: flex-end;z-index:1;}
.about02::after{content:"";position: absolute;left:0;right:0;bottom:0;height:270px;background-color:#f7f7f7;z-index:-1;}
.about02 .box{box-shadow:0 0 20px rgba(0,0,0,.2);}
.about03{padding-top:140px;background-color:#f7f7f7;}
.about03 .slide{margin-top:-56px;}
.about03 .txt-body{display:flex;justify-content:space-between;min-height:630px;}
.about03 .text{width:calc(100% - 385px);padding-top:56px;}
.about03 .text h4{font-size:26px;line-height:26px;color:#666666;font-weight:bold;}
.about03 .text h5{font-size:16px;line-height:26px;color:#666;margin-bottom:55px;}
.about03 .text p{font-size:18px;line-height:32px;color:#666;}
.about03 .text p.p_1{padding-left:15px;}
.about03 .text p.p_1 em{margin-left:-15px;}
.about03 .img{width:385px;height:500px;align-self:flex-end}
.about03 .img img{object-fit: cover;width:100%;height:100%;}


.about04{background-color:#db313c;}
.about04 .txt-body{padding:50px 0;background:url(../images/about/about-4-bg-1.png) no-repeat left top;}
.about04 .txt-body .img-box{padding-right:170px;padding-top:60px;background:url(../images/about/about-4-bg-2.png) no-repeat right top;text-align:right;float:right;}
.about04 .txt-body .img-box .img{box-shadow:0 0 10px rgba(92,88,88,.63);margin-bottom:20px;}
.about04 .txt-body .img-box p a{display:inline-block;font-size:15px;line-height:30px;font-weight:bold;color:#fff;text-decoration:none;cursor:pointer;}
.about04 .txt-body .img-box p a i{width:23px;height:30px;background:url(../images/common/filed_arrow_w.png) no-repeat center;float:right;margin-left:15px;}
.about04 .txt-body .test-box{padding-top:70px;}
.about04 .txt-body .test-box h3{font-size:38px;font-weight:bold;color:#fff;position: relative;line-height:38px;padding-bottom:18px;margin-bottom:35px;}
.about04 .txt-body .test-box h3::before{content:"";display:inline-block;width:34px;height:34px;background:url(../images/about/about-1-h3.png) no-repeat;position: absolute;left:-23px;top:-20px;}
.about04 .txt-body .test-box h3::after{content:"";display:inline-block;width:30px;height:4px;background-color:#fff;position:absolute;left:0;bottom:0px;}
.about04 .txt-body .test-box .slide{width:100%;overflow:hidden;margin-top:-89px;position: relative;}
.about04 .txt-body .test-box .slide .swiper-slide .txt-box{float:left;width:600px;margin-top:89px}
.about04 .txt-body .test-box .slide .swiper-slide h4{font-size:26px;font-weight:bold;color:#fff;margin-bottom:15px;}
.about04 .txt-body .test-box .slide .swiper-slide h5{font-size:16px;line-height:22px;color:rgba(255,255,255,.68);margin-bottom:20px;}
.about04 .txt-body .test-box .slide .swiper-slide p{font-size:18px;line-height:34px;color:#fff;}
.about04 .txt-body .test-box .slide .slide-btn{position: absolute;left:0;bottom:0;z-index:4;}
.about04 .txt-body .test-box .slide .slide-btn a{display:inline-block;width:52px;height:52px;border:1px solid #fff;border-radius:50%;cursor:pointer;margin-right:20px;outline:0;}
.about04 .txt-body .test-box .slide .slide-btn a.left{background:url(../images/common/left_w.png) no-repeat center;}
.about04 .txt-body .test-box .slide .slide-btn a.right{background:url(../images/common/right_w.png) no-repeat center;}
.about04 .txt-body .test-box .slide .slide-btn a.left:hover{background:#fff url(../images/common/left_b.png) no-repeat center;}
.about04 .txt-body .test-box .slide .slide-btn a.right:hover{background:#fff url(../images/common/right_b.png) no-repeat center;}
.popAbout{position:fixed;left:0;right:0;top:0;bottom:0;background-color:rgba(0,0,0,.78);z-index:9999;display:none;}
.popAbout .txt-body{position:absolute;top:50%;left:50%;transform: translate(-50%,-50%);width:770px;}
.popAbout .txt-body .txt{padding:40px;background-color:#fff;font-size:18px;line-height:32px;color:#666;}
.popAbout .txt-body .closed{display:inline-block;width:59px;height:59px;background:url(../images/about/close.jpg);cursor:pointer;position: absolute;right:-59px;top:0;}
.about05{padding:65px 0;display:flex;justify-content:space-between;}
.about05 .img{width:600px;text-align:center;}
.about05 h3{margin-top:30px;}
.about05 h4{font-size:20px;line-height:26px;color:#666;font-weight:bold;margin-bottom:30px;}
.about05 a{display:inline-block;font-size:15px;line-height:30px;font-weight:bold;color:#000;text-decoration:none;cursor:pointer;}
.about05 a i{width:23px;height:30px;background:url(../images/common/filed_arrow_b.png) no-repeat center;float:right;margin-left:15px;}
.about05 a:hover{color:#136dae;}
.about05 a:hover i{background:url(../images/common/filed_arrow.png) no-repeat center }






























































































































































































































































